that means like reporting for a television station or writing for a newspaper. basically like, covering news and stuff in various ways. there are different types of journalism, from like the news on cnn or nbc to simply school yearbooks that cover things that happen. if a student takes a journalism class in high school, they would be writing for the high school newspaper. so your friend probably wants to be a news reporter or write for a newspaper or something. ]
